  2. About Us Statistics is the science of collecting, analyzing, interpreting, and presenting data. It helps in decision-making by providing insights from data. Key areas: Descriptive and Inferential Statistics. Practical Application: Used in fields like Economics, Business, Medicine, and Social Sciences.   3. Common Topics in Statistics Assignments Descriptive Statistics: Mean, median, mode, variance, standard deviation. Probability: Concepts like independent events, conditional probability. Hypothesis Testing: T-tests, Chi-square tests, and p-values. Regression Analysis: Simple linear regression, multiple regression. ANOVA (Analysis of Variance): Comparing means of three or more groups.
